Moving Email to DevonThink -- Not Working. Please help!

I want to archive my email to DTP. I have tried using the “Import” feature of DTP, and the Apple Mail Plug-in with no success.

When I use the Apple Mail Plug-in, it moves an empty mailbox. I tried moving my Gmail “All Mail” folder. I went to Apple Mail and choose “All Mail.” Then from the “Mailbox” menu, I chose “Add to DevonThink 3.” It took some time to process and moved the mailbox. The mailbox showed up empty.

When I use the “Import Feature” it does not load any messages for the mailbox I want to archive.

As it’s a large number of messages and they might not all be (fully) available locally, it’s possible that it’s a timeout. Please choose Help > Report Bug while pressing the Alt modifier key and send the result to cgrunenberg - at - devon-technologies.com - thanks!

What’s the best way to get emails in DTP in the meantime?

One workaround might be to use the scripts for Apple Mail, see Scripts menu extra after installing additional scripts via DEVONthink 3 > Install Add-Ons…

I have these add-ons installed. However, O don’t see the scripts for Apple Mail in my scripts menu (in DTP or in my universal scripts on my computer). Where would these script show up on a Mac?

In the Scripts menu extra of the computer while Apple Mail is active.

When I have large volumes of mail to archive, I export an mbox from the Mail app, then import that into DT. Works well.

That’s a great idea. If I import the same mailbox more then once, will it overwrite the existing emails in DTP?

Emails already added to the database are skipped (or optionally replicated, see Preferences > Email).
